That's the cam chain tensioner. You need to remove it to get some slack in the cam chain so you can remove the cam / cam sprocket.


You need to take out the bolt on top of the tensioner and replace it with a longer bolt that will screw down on the tensioner pin (so the tensioner pin doesn't fall out into the engine), then unbolt the tensioner mounting bolts and remove the unit (so it looks like the 2nd manual pic)


All this should become clear as to "why" when you do it.

Remove the bolt on top of the tensioner, and replace it with a longer bolt (D in the pic) to hold things in place. Then remove the E bolts and take the apparatus off the cylinders. The lock-bolt and washer shown laying on the engine case is the original after it's been taken out and replaced with D.
